Share

For experienced computer programmers, a well-structured resume that highlights technical expertise, leadership, and quantifiable achievements is the most critical factor in securing interviews. Based on analysis of successful tech resumes, the optimal template focuses on a professional summary, a detailed technology summary, and accomplishment-driven experience sections to demonstrate immediate value to employers.
A senior-level programmer's resume must move beyond basic job duties to showcase impact and leadership. The goal is to pass through Applicant Tracking Systems (ATS)—software used by companies to automatically screen resumes—while also impressing human recruiters. The resume should be built around several core components:
The format of your resume directly influences its readability and effectiveness. A clean, reverse-chronological format is widely accepted as the industry standard. Key formatting guidelines include:
To illustrate the effectiveness of a well-structured resume, the following table compares key elements from a standard resume versus an optimized one.
| Resume Element | Standard Version | Optimized, High-Impact Version |
|---|---|---|
| Professional Summary | "Programmer with experience in Java." | "Lead Programmer with a 10-year track record of architecting scalable Java solutions that improve operational efficiency and reduce costs." |
| Listing Skills | "Knows Java, Python, SQL." | Programming Languages: Java, C++, Python, SQL. Frameworks: J2EE, AngularJS. Databases: MySQL, SQL Server. |
| Describing Achievements | "Responsible for coding new features." | "Developed and implemented cross-platform solutions that increased system scalability by 75% and completed the project under budget." |
According to the U.S. Bureau of Labor Statistics (BLS), the job market for computer programmers is robust, with a median annual wage of $99,700 ($47.94 per hour). While programming can often be done remotely, employment hotspots remain concentrated in major tech hubs. The states with the highest employment levels are California, Texas, New York, Illinois, and New Jersey. Top metropolitan areas include New York City, Seattle, Chicago, Dallas, and Los Angeles. Targeting companies in these regions can increase the number of relevant job openings.
Before submitting your resume, a meticulous review is essential. Even minor errors can lead to immediate rejection. Based on our assessment experience, follow these final steps:
To stand out in a competitive field, your resume must be a strategic document that proves your value. Focus on quantifiable achievements, a clean and ATS-friendly format, and meticulous tailoring for each job application. A well-optimized resume is not just a history of your work; it's your primary marketing tool.









